When I've setup ProBIND, I've done it with the remote update script.  You 
should be able to follow the steps manually if you use the remote update 
script too and I imagine a similar sort of logic probably works for the local 
update script as well, but I'm not familiar with how it pushes files.

Anyway, for the remote one, login to the server as the user that apache runs 
as.  SSH with key authentication to the user that runs BIND @localhost and 
confirm that you can do that without any prompts.  Try to write to the BIND 
config/zonefiles to ensure you have proper permissions to create/edit files 
there.  Then run rndc to reload the BIND zones and confirm that it works 
properly.  If things aren't working, then one of those steps probably 
required some input (password prompt) or gave an error or something.
